Blooie's:

It's a bit of the western style kind of roadhouse, serve western and local food, decent prices, great hangout. Couple of tables outside on small square along the road, inside there's a nice bar and a pool table as well.

It is located at Jalan Tua Kong: At the junction of Siglap road and Upper east coast road, when facing siglap center (shopping mall) (left side), turn right on Upper east coast road. On your left side you will see a few restaurants (lemongrass, vietnamese rest. video shop etc) then at the second road on the left, is Jalan Tua Kong, it is opposite the public parking next to Siglap coffeeshop and the famous Werner's Oven shop/restaurant. Drive inside, about 250m on the left side is Blooie's.
